1952–53 Welsh Cup

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

1952–53 Welsh Cup
Tournament details
CountryWales
Final positions
ChampionsWales Rhyl
Runner-upEngland Chester

The 1952–53 FAW Welsh Cup is the 66th season of the annual knockout tournament for competitive football teams in Wales.

Fifth round

Eight winners from the Fourth round and ten new clubs.

Tie no Home Score Away
1 Wrexham (FL D3N) 3–4 Chester (FL D3N)

Sixth round

Three winners from the Fifth round plus Pwllheli & District. Six clubs get a bye to the Seventh round.

Tie no Home Score Away
1 Chester (FL D3N) 2–0 Pwllheli & District (WLN)

Seventh round

Tie no Home Score Away
1 Chester (FL D3N) 5–0 Lovell's Athletic (SFL)

Semifinal

Chester and Connah's Quay Nomads played at Wrexham.

Tie no Home Score Away
1 Rhyl (CCL) 1–0 Cardiff City (FL D1)
2 Chester (FL D3N) 5–0 Connah's Quay Nomads (WLN)

Final

Final were held at Bangor.

Tie no Home Score Away
1 Rhyl (CCL) 2–1 Chester (FL D3N)
